Annotation

CROSS-BORDER TASKS More and more companies are looking for junior engineers with an interdisciplinary education. In particular specialists are in demand who can comprehensively process and assess issues from a technical and economic perspective. The course Industrial Engineering, Mechanical Engineering combines technical-scientific, mechanical-engineering as well as economic, legal and social-science contents.

Admission requirements

Admission requirements for the degree course with integrated training For admission to a dual degree course you must have a general or subject-restricted higher education entrance qualification or a higher education entrance qualification for universities of applied sciences. A cooperation agreement for the dual degree must also exist between the higher education institution and the company with which you will be completing your training.
